仍处于开发阶段的 GNOME 3.38 近日合并了一个大的变更,这将使 Wayland 游戏玩家和其他玩家受益。
来自 Red Hat 的 Jonas Ådahl 致力于实现 Wayland 的非重定向全屏,以在运行全屏游戏时绕过合成器(compositing),类似的变更已被合并到 Mutter。当应用程序/游戏占据桌面的整个区域时,通过此功能基本上避免了额外的合成器工作。对于运行 GNOME Wayland 会话的游戏玩家来说,这种通过非重定向全屏的方式来绕过 Mutter 进行合成,应该会对性能有明显的帮助。
GNOME 的 X11 代码已经支持这种全屏旁路合成,而 Mutter Wayland 的代码在经过审查了七个月的补丁之后,现在终于在 Git master 中看到了类似的处理。
更多细节请查看这个现在被认可的合并请求。在 GNOME 3.36 / Ubuntu 20.04 X.Org vs. (X)Wayland 会话中的游戏性能表现已经相当不错,而这个 Wayland 功能有助于解决 Wayland 合成器在 GNOME 上的性能问题。
猜你喜欢:暂无回复。